User Servicing Instructions
1. Using the product controls, turn off the appliance.
2. Grasp the plug (not the cord) and disconnect from the
outlet.
3. Risk of Fire. Replace fuse only with 2.5 Amp, 125 Volt
fuse as approved by Vornado Consumer Service. For an
authorized replacement fuse, please contact Vornado
Consumer Service.
4. Once the replacement is received, use a small at-head
screwdriver to slide open the fuse cover (located on the
plug) (See next page, Fig. A).
5. Remove fuse by using the screwdriver to gently lift each
end of the fuse (See next page, Fig. B).
6. Install the replacement fuse by using the screwdriver
to gently push each metal end of the fuse into the
receptacle one at a time. Do not push on the center of
the fuse—it is fragile and may break.
7. Slide the fuse cover closed using the screwdriver. When
closed, the cover should t completely in the plug. No
part of the cover should stick out (See next page, Fig.
C).
8. Plug your appliance into the outlet and turn the power
on.
9. If the replacement fuse blows, a short-circuit may
be present and the product should be discarded or
returned to an authorized service facility for examination
and/or repair.
Risk of re. Do not replace attachment plug. Contains a safety
device (fuse, AFCI, LCDI) that should not be removed. Discard
product if the attachment plug is damaged.
FCC Consumer Advisement
This equipment may generate, use and/or radiate radio
frequency energy that may cause harmful interference to
radio communications. If this equipment does cause harmful
interference to radio or television reception, which can be
determ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user is
encouraged to contact Vornado Consumer Service. Changes or
modications to this unit not expressly approved by the party
responsible for compliance could void the user’s authority to
operate the product.
